Firefox 3a1 Coming Soon

The first Firefox 3 (Grand Paradiso) developmental milestone, Alpha 1 is set for next Tuesday, November 28th. Not really sure yet what features are going to be a part of this milestone. I have heard over at CyberNet: Firefox 3 To Have Advanced Microsummaries and it will be Acid 2 compliant. But that is about all I know for now besides the fact it will be built off the Gecko 1.9 trunk (Minefield).

The Firefox Kid

This month’s IEEE Spectrum Magazine cover story is The Firefox Kid (Blake Ross). The bulk of the article serves as an introduction to Blake Ross & Joe Hewitt’s joint project, Parakey. Other parts of the article include Blake’s childhood “as part of the first generation to grow up with the Internet.”, how Phoenix/Firebird/Firefox came about and an humorous account of a dinner with Microsoft’s Internet Explorer team after Firefox became popular.
